Transaction ef6befb49c0a05b28530f9a9a00606d91567ff8d82ee45c0a10a9951431100c3
1 Input
1 Output
-
ef6befb49c0a05b28530f9a9a00606d91567ff8d82ee45c0a10a9951431100c3:0
- value
- 658575
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c5af55ac4b22f7be05b9d7858648dcd80de9807
- address
- bc1q33d02kkykghhhczmn4u9seydekqdaxq8nncath